Boogie Nights is a wondrous masterpiece and my first P.T. Anderson film (I know. I'm way behind the ball here). There's never a dull moment during its two-and-a-half running time since it's so epic in scope in covering the lives of its characters and all their flaws.
It's a film that's all about sex, drugs, violence, and everything that 70's and 80's represented. Boogie Nights is nothing short of a masterpiece and is well worth seeing.
